Why Locker Size Matters
Not all luggage is the same. From small backpacks to oversized suitcases, each traveler carries different baggage. Traditional lockers at stations typically come in small, medium, and large sizes, each with strict dimension limits.
Small lockers: Suitable for handbags or small backpacks
Medium lockers: Ideal for cabin-size luggage
Large lockers: Designed for bigger suitcases
However, even the largest lockers have limits (around 90 cm height), which may not fit bulky or irregular luggage.

How to Choose the Right Locker Size
If you are using traditional lockers, follow these steps:
1. Measure Your Luggage
Check height, width, and depth before booking. Compare with locker dimensions.
2. Consider Quantity
If you have multiple bags, a larger locker may be more economical than booking several small ones.
3. Think About Accessibility
Some lockers charge extra if you reopen them during the rental period.
4. Plan Your Travel Time
